Lead Dotnet Developer (2455459) at Tier4 Group in Gainesville, Georgia

Posted in Other about 3 hours ago.

Type: full-time





Job Description:

This role is ideal for an a senior engineer looking to move into an architect position. If you are looking to grow in a hands-on, fast-paced environment while driving innovation and development excellence. If you're passionate about designing cutting-edge applications and leading technology-forward initiatives, we encourage you to apply!

The ideal candidate will be familiar with the full software design life cycle. They should have experience in designing, coding, testing and consistently managing applications They should be comfortable coding in a number of languages and have an ability to test code in order to maintain high-quality code.

About the role
  • Design, code, test and manage various applications
  • Collaborate with engineering team and product team to establish best products
  • Follow outlined standards of quality related to code and systems
  • Develop automated tests and conduct performance tuning
  • Proven expertise in building and scaling applications using .NET technologies and React framework.
  • Proficient in SQL database design, complex queries, and data optimization.
  • Strong experience with Azure cloud services for application deployment and CI/CD pipelines using Azure DevOps.
  • Expertise in software architecture design and implementation.
  • Familiarity with Agile methodologies and secure coding practices.
  • Experience with optimizing application performance and conducting code reviews.
  • Familiarity with Google Play and Apple App Store deployments.
  • Experience with Docker for containerized applications and knowledge of container orchestration.
  • Proficiency with monitoring, logging tools, and automated testing integrations.
  • Excellent communication skills and the ability to create detailed technical documentation.
  • Strong time management and organizational skills.

Key Responsibilities:

Strategy & Design:
  • Lead the transition to innovative application architectures aligned with business goals and technological advancements.
  • Develop frameworks that promote reuse, reduce costs, and accelerate speed to market for scalable, efficient solutions.
  • Create and maintain comprehensive documentation, including current and future architecture roadmaps and technology standards.
  • Stay updated on the latest technologies and industry best practices to foster continuous improvement and innovation within the team.

Implementation:
  • Enhance and optimize API and Microservices integration for improved system interoperability and scalability.
  • Guide teams in developing and validating proofs-of-concept (PoCs) and proofs-of-value (PoVs) to explore new ideas and assess their benefits.
  • Oversee application version upgrades and ensure compliance with security standards to maintain robust applications.
  • Manage mobile application submissions and updates in app stores, ensuring compliance with guidelines and enhancing the user experience.

Collaboration:
  • Provide expert advice on architectural decisions and technical strategies to ensure successful project outcomes.
  • Advocate for DevOps practices to improve collaboration between development, operations, and security teams.
  • Collaborate with Agile teams and infrastructure experts to optimize development and deployment environments for seamless performance.
  • Support the Project Management Office (PMO) and scrum teams with technical insights and solutions, aligning project deliverables with architectural goals.

Position Requirements:

Education & Certification:
  • Bachelor's degree in Computer Science, Information Systems, or equivalent experience required.

Knowledge & Experience:
  • 5+ years leading architectural design and strategy, guiding software development teams, and promoting best practices.
  • 5+ years of experience developing applications using .NET and React, with strong SQL skills for database design and management.
  • 5+ years of expertise leveraging Azure cloud services for application deployment and management, including Azure DevOps for CI/CD processes.

More jobs in Gainesville, Georgia

Other
about 3 hours ago

Open Systems Inc.
Other
about 4 hours ago

TRC Talent Solutions
More jobs in Other

Other
5 minutes ago

SubCom
Other
5 minutes ago

NEWMARK
Other
5 minutes ago

NEWMARK